TURN-208: Gatevale turnstile counters at the Merrow Field pilot double-count when a rotation reverses mid-cycle. Attendance totals drift roughly 2% high per event. The debounce window fix is implemented, reviewed by Ilsa, and soak-tested across two simulated match days without drift. Ready for your cut; the candidate build is identified below.

trace token, tagag-tafog: htk6_5ed18c

Subject: Quickstore 4.2 — bloom filter now fronts the KV layer

Plugin authors: starting with this release, Quickstore places a bloom filter ahead of the key-value store. Negative lookups return faster; false positives fall through safely. No API changes are required on your side. Verify your plugin against the staging build referenced below.

session token of fahif-tadup = htk3_9c7

## LiftSim dispatch runbook

When the Vertigo elevator-dispatch simulator wedges mid-scenario, don't just kill it — drain the scenario queue first with `liftsim drain`, then restart the worker. It reconnects to the Shaftline results store automatically, but only if its env file is intact. Copy the file from the template before restarting. The results-store access secret belongs on the very next line.

vault entry, kafog-yahop: COURIER_KEY8=0faa53ae

## 4.2.0 — Catalogue Import

Added bulk import pipeline for the Shelfmark library catalogue. MARC-ish records from the Brindlewood archive now map to the internal schema, with duplicate detection on title-plus-year. Failed rows land in a quarantine table instead of aborting the run. Import throughput tested at 40k records per batch. Review focus: the dedupe heuristics in importer/match.py. The engineer accountable for this change is named below.

account owner for bawip-tahag: Raleth Quenok

### Runbook: weather-alert fan-out (plugin authors)

Quick orientation: when Stormlark receives an upstream alert, the fan-out service pushes it to every registered plugin endpoint within about four seconds. If your plugin misses alerts, check your ack handler first — unacked deliveries retry three times, then park in the Driftwell dead-letter queue. You can replay parked alerts yourself from the dev console; no need to page us. When reporting fan-out issues, include the token printed below.

session token of yajof-bagef = htk4_937d